Product Details

Product Description

The TSXETG100 from Schneider Electric is a versatile Ethernet/Modbus gateway designed for Modicon X80 systems. It enables seamless communication between Ethernet networks and Modbus-compatible devices, ensuring reliable data exchange across automation systems.

Built for industrial performance, the TSXETG100 supports high-speed networking, stable connectivity, and easy integration into existing control infrastructures. Its compact form factor and flexible protocol support make it an ideal choice for robust industrial automation applications.

Specifications

 Product Range: Modicon X80 automation platform

 Product Category: Ethernet/Modbus Gateway

 Communication Protocol: Ethernet TCP/IP, Modbus RTU/ASCII

 Power Supply: 24 VDC nominal, <3 W typical consumption

 LED Indicators: Status, communication activity, and error signaling

 Operating Temperature: 0…60 °C (32…140 °F)

 Storage Temperature: -40…85 °C (-40…185 °F)

 Humidity: 5…95 % RH, non-condensing

 Dimensions (L×W×H): 110 × 75 × 35 mm

 Net Weight: 0.18 kg

 Packaging: Individual unit (PCE), optional bulk packages available
